New Gaming OS Anatase Looks Like an Interesting Bazzite/CachyOS Alternative

I just came across **Anatase**, a new Linux gaming OS aimed at handheld PCs, and it looks genuinely interesting. It seems to take a lot of the ideas that make SteamOS and Bazzite work so well on handhelds — booting straight into a controller-friendly gaming mode, TDP controls, VRR, HDR, FPS limiting, gyro support, etc. — but there are a couple of things that make Anatase stand out. One of them is that they want to use a **single image across handhelds, laptops, desktops and HTPCs**, with support for AMD, Intel and NVIDIA hardware. They already list support for a pretty large number of handhelds, including the ROG Ally, Legion Go, MSI Claw, GPD, Ayaneo and OneXPlayer devices. It also integrates **HHD (Handheld Daemon)** and has system-level 2x frame generation available from Game Mode, which could be particularly useful on lower-powered handhelds. But the part I find most interesting is **Spaces**. The base OS is immutable, but you can create isolated Arch, Fedora, Ubuntu, Kali, etc. environments and install software from those distributions without messing with the base system. So in theory you get the reliability of an immutable gaming OS without making the machine annoying to use as an actual Linux PC. Desktop mode uses KDE Plasma, so you can still dock the handheld and use it like a normal computer. Obviously it's a very new project, so I wouldn't replace a perfectly working Bazzite or SteamOS installation expecting everything to be better straight away. There are going to be bugs and hardware-specific issues to iron out. Still, this looks like one of the more interesting Linux gaming projects I've seen recently, especially for handheld PCs.
